Essential Ingredients for Your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Alright, let’s talk about what makes this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on sing! It’s all about using good stuff, you know? You’ll want about 2 ounces of a really nice bourbon – pick one you actually like drinking on its own, it makes a difference! Then we’ve got our honey syrup, which is super easy to make. You’ll need 1 ounce of that. Fresh lemon juice is key here too, just half an ounce, to give it that little zing. And for that extra layer of complexity, we’re adding 2 dashes of Angostura bitters and 2 dashes of orange bitters. Trust me, don’t skip the orange bitters, they really brighten things up! For the garnish, grab a nice, thick piece of orange peel and a whole cinnamon stick – they’re not just for looks, they add amazing aroma!

Preparing the Honey Syrup

Making your own honey syrup is a game-changer for this drink. It’s ridiculously simple! Just grab equal parts honey and hot water – so, say, half a cup of honey and half a cup of hot water. Stir it all up until the honey is completely dissolved. Let it cool down before you use it in the cocktail. This way, it mixes in smoothly and gives you just the right amount of sweetness. It’ll keep in the fridge for a few weeks, too, so you can make a batch ahead of time!

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Alright, let’s get this festive drink made! It’s really straightforward, so don’t worry if you haven’t made cocktails before. First things first, if you want to be extra fancy, pop your rocks glass into the freezer for a few minutes while you get everything else ready. This keeps your drink colder for longer. Now, grab your mixing glass – that’s the sturdy one you’ll mix the ingredients in. We’re going to add our bourbon, that lovely honey syrup, the fresh lemon juice, and both the Angostura and orange bitters right into it. Just pour them all in!

Mixing and Chilling Your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Now for the important part: stirring! For a drink like our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on, we want it chilled and smooth, not frothy like a shaken drink. So, fill your mixing glass about two-thirds of the way with ice. Grab your bar spoon – or even a regular spoon if that’s what you have – and stir gently but continuously. You’re aiming for about 20 to 30 seconds. You’ll feel the outside of the glass get nice and frosty. This chilling process is crucial for getting that perfect, silky texture and making sure all those flavors meld together beautifully without getting watered down too quickly.

Straining and Garnishing Your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Once it’s perfectly chilled, it’s time to strain. Take your mixing glass and a cocktail strainer (or a small sieve if you don’t have one) and pour the liquid into your prepared rocks glass, making sure to strain out the ice from the mixing glass. Pop a big, nice ice cube into the glass – these melt slower, keeping your drink perfectly chilled. Finally, for that amazing aroma and visual flair, take your orange peel, give it a little twist over the drink to release its oils, and then drop it in. Add your cinnamon stick to complete the look. Cheers to your beautiful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on!

Sweetness Adjustment for Your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Sweetness is such a personal thing, right? My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on recipe is balanced, but you might like yours a little sweeter or a little less so. That’s where the honey syrup comes in! If you prefer a sweeter drink, just add a little extra honey syrup, maybe an extra quarter-ounce or so. If you like it a bit drier, start with a little less. The best way to do it is to add your initial amount, stir everything up, give it a tiny taste (carefully, of course!), and then add more honey syrup if you think it needs it. It’s your drink, make it perfect for *you*!

Frequently Asked Questions about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Got questions about my favorite holiday sipper? I’ve got answers! People often ask if they can make a non-alcoholic version, and yes, you totally can! Just swap out the bourbon for a good quality spiced apple cider or even a non-alcoholic spirit if you have one. It’s still lovely and festive. Another common question is about the bourbon itself. For this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on, I really love using a smooth bourbon with some nice caramel or vanilla notes. Something like a Buffalo Trace or Maker’s Mark works beautifully because they complement the honey and spices without being too harsh. And for parties, I get asked about batching it. While cocktails are best made fresh, you *can* pre-mix the bourbon, honey syrup, lemon juice, and bitters ahead of time, and then just stir with ice and strain when you’re ready to serve!

Best Bourbon Choices for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Choosing the right bourbon really does make a difference for this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on. You want something that’s smooth and has those warm, comforting flavors that go hand-in-hand with the holidays. I’d recommend bourbons that have notes of caramel, vanilla, or even a hint of oak. Brands like Maker’s Mark, Buffalo Trace, or Four Roses are usually fantastic choices. They’ll blend beautifully with the honey and spices without being too sharp or overpowering. Avoid anything too high-proof or aggressively flavored, as it might clash!

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on

Christmas Honey Spiced Bourbon: 1 Festive Sip


  • Author: cocktailmixguide.com
  • Total Time: 5 minutes
  • Yield: 1 serving 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A festive and warming cocktail featuring the rich flavors of bourbon, honey, and warming spices, perfect for the holiday season.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 oz Bourbon
  • 1 oz Honey Syrup (1:1 honey and water)
  • 0.5 oz Fresh Lemon Juice
  • 2 dashes Angostura Bitters
  • 2 dashes Orange Bitters
  • Garnish: Orange peel and a cinnamon stick

Instructions

  1. Combine bourbon, honey syrup, lemon juice, and bitters in a mixing glass.
  2. Add ice and stir until well-chilled.
  3. Strain into a rocks glass over a large ice cube.
  4. Garnish with an orange peel and a cinnamon stick.

Notes

  • For a spicier kick, add a pinch of ground cloves or nutmeg to the mixing glass.
  • Adjust the amount of honey syrup to your preferred sweetness.
  • If you don’t have honey syrup, you can use 0.75 oz of honey and muddle it slightly with the lemon juice before adding other ingredients.
